| Title | Tenda FH451 v1.0.0.9 Stack-based Buffer Overflow |
|---|
| Description | The router FH451V1.0.0.9 from Shenzhen Tenda Technology Co., Ltd. contains a binary stack overflow vulnerability located within the fromWizardHandle function. This function receives a parameter a1 via a POST request and extracts variables WANT and WANS from it. When WANS equals 1 and WANT equals 2, the execution enters a conditional branch. Within this branch, the function sub_3C434 is called, which unsafely copies the PPW value from a1 into a 256-byte buffer without performing any bounds checking. An attacker can exploit this vulnerability to cause a denial of service (DoS). Furthermore, it can be leveraged to construct a ROP (Return-Oriented Programming) chain to overwrite the return address, enabling privilege escalation or remote code execution (RCE). |
